In today's digitally connected world, safeguarding personal and organizational data has become more crucial than ever. Cyber threats are evolving, and with them, the need for stronger security measures. One such robust security mechanism is Multi-Factor Authentication (MFA). MFA is not just a buzzword but a vital layer of security that significantly enhances the protection of digital assets.
Understanding Multi-Factor Authentication
Multi-Factor Authentication (MFA) is a security process that requires users to verify their identity through multiple forms of evidence before accessing a system, application, or data. Instead of relying solely on a password, MFA combines two or more independent credentials from different categories, making it much harder for unauthorized users to gain access.
The Factors of MFA
MFA typically involves three categories of factors:
- Something You Know:
- This factor includes information only the user should know, such as passwords, PINs, or answers to security questions.
- Something You Have:
- This factor involves physical items in the user's possession. Examples include smartphones (for receiving verification codes), security tokens, smart cards, or other hardware devices.
- Something You Are:
- This factor uses biometric data unique to the user. Common examples are fingerprint scans, facial recognition, voice recognition, and retina scans.
How MFA Works
The MFA process generally follows these steps:
- User Initiates Login:
- The user enters their username and password (something they know).
- Additional Verification Required:
- After the initial credential is accepted, the system prompts the user for an additional verification method.
- Verification of Second Factor:
- The user must provide the second factor, such as a code sent to their smartphone (something they have) or a fingerprint scan (something they are).
- Access Granted:
- Once the second factor is successfully verified, the user is granted access to the system.
Benefits of Multi-Factor Authentication
- Enhanced Security:
- MFA provides an extra layer of security, making it significantly more difficult for attackers to gain unauthorized access. Even if one factor is compromised, the attacker would still need the other factors to breach the system.
- Protection Against Credential Theft:
- Passwords alone are vulnerable to various attacks like phishing, brute force, and credential stuffing. MFA mitigates these risks by requiring additional verification.
- Compliance and Regulatory Requirements:
- Many industries and regulatory bodies now mandate the use of MFA to protect sensitive data. Implementing MFA helps organizations comply with these standards.
- User Confidence:
- Knowing that MFA is in place can boost user confidence in the security of their accounts and personal information.
Implementing MFA: Best Practices
- Choose the Right MFA Solution:
- Select an MFA solution that suits your organization’s needs. Consider factors like ease of use, compatibility with existing systems, and the level of security provided.
- Educate Users:
- Training users on the importance of MFA and how to use it correctly is crucial. Address any concerns they may have about usability and convenience.
- Regularly Update MFA Methods:
- Cyber threats are continuously evolving. Regularly update and review MFA methods to ensure they remain effective against new threats.
- Backup Options:
- Provide users with backup options in case they lose access to their primary MFA device. This could include backup codes, secondary email addresses, or alternative authentication methods.
- Monitor and Analyze:
- Continuously monitor authentication attempts and analyze any suspicious activities. Use this data to enhance and fine-tune your MFA implementation.
Challenges and Considerations
While MFA significantly boosts security, it is not without challenges:
- User Resistance:
- Some users may find MFA cumbersome and inconvenient. Addressing their concerns and emphasizing the security benefits can help ease this resistance.
- Implementation Costs:
- Deploying MFA can involve initial setup costs and ongoing maintenance. However, the investment is justified by the substantial increase in security.
- Device Dependency:
- MFA often relies on devices like smartphones or hardware tokens. Ensuring users have access to these devices at all times is essential for seamless authentication.
Conclusion
Multi-Factor Authentication (MFA) is a powerful tool in the fight against cyber threats. By requiring multiple forms of verification, MFA adds a robust layer of security that protects against unauthorized access. As cyber threats continue to grow in sophistication, implementing MFA is not just an option but a necessity for individuals and organizations alike. Embrace MFA to secure your digital world—because in cybersecurity, every extra layer of protection counts.